Need a Hostess Gift?
If you are attending a party this holiday season or a summer BBQ outdoor party you may want to pick up the host and hostess a gift to say "thank you". A hostess gift shows good manners and tells your host/hostess that you appreciate the effort they put forth in the party and the fact that they invited you. Your Hostess Would Love Something Other Than Wine as a Thank You Gift
Don't bring that traditional boring bottle of wine to your beautiful hostess or handsome host this holiday season, bring something to wow them and make them feel really special. Sure wine is wonderful to bring if you were asked to bring it, but surely your host doesn't need 20 bottles of wine for the evening, so unless they are a wine collector or enjoy wine on a regular basis your gift is likely doomed to sit around in the basement or pantry for awhile.
